A dispute has intensified between Israel, US President Donald Trump's special envoy to Syria Tom Barrack, and some Trump allies over Barrack's recent comments regarding the Golan Heights and Turkey's involvement in Syria. Israeli Foreign Minister Gideon Sa'ar criticized Barrack's statements as "full of inaccuracies" and contradictory to President Trump's own policy on the Golan Heights.

Conservative activist Laura Loomer, who has close ties to Trump, also joined the criticism. Loomer called for Barrack's resignation, citing a lack of understanding of US foreign policy and pointing to Trump's 2019 proclamation on the Golan Heights. She previously criticized Barrack for condemning an Israeli strike on a Syrian base, calling him "one of the worst choices of the Trump administration."

Adding to the controversy, Loomer claimed Turkey is attempting to deploy Russian air defense systems in Syria. A source confirmed to The Jerusalem Post that Turkey is indeed seeking to deploy radar and potentially air defense systems. Barrack, however, presented a different view, describing the Syrian government as non-aggressive and stating Ankara is not interested in a military confrontation with Israel. He also described the Israeli strike as an "unnecessary escalation."

An editorial in the New York Sun described Barrack as acting independently at times and suggested he appears more aligned with Turkish President Erdogan than with US policy. The newspaper also noted a gap between Barrack's swift condemnation of the Syria strike and President Trump's more reserved public response.
